Output dd6e523d06283acd65c602682970a24829dffbc28169ba009be762f3799d16e4:0
- value
- 525000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51fd7b48ad7a6fb71a01c4a20edfd81c7cd9f058 OP_EQUAL
- address
- 39AYKHpWNcMW91fxY2TLnHA7YViJWhd12k
- transaction
- dd6e523d06283acd65c602682970a24829dffbc28169ba009be762f3799d16e4
- confirmations
- 291899
- spent
- true